In order to study MBBS, you have to give NEET. NEET is national level undergraduate medical entrance exam to get admission in medical, dental, AYUSH, BVSc and AH colleges in India. Also, admissions to AIIMS and JIPMER are done through NEET exam. The eligibility criteria for NEET exam is:

  • The candidates need to pass class 12 or equivalent exam with PCB and need to secure minimum 50% in PCB and aggregate( for general candidate) and 40%(for SC/ST)
  • The minimum age of the candidate should be 17 years.
  • Also, there is no upper age limit.

Based on the NEET rank you have to appear for the counselling procedure. You can apply for both All India counselling and you respective state counselling. The candidates are allotted seats through the counselling procedure.
